摘  要:针对常规线性变换获得的多分量成分可能不相干,但通常不满足统计独立的特点,提出了一种基于独立函数元的信号分解和重构的方法.该方法不仅继承了线性变换的诸多优点,而且还有统计域表征的优点.讨论了独立函数元的模型、定义和获取方法,详细分析了心音独立函数元在心音信号处理方面的应用.实验验证了所述方法的有效性和实用性.In the paper, we present a new method for signal processing in statistical domain. The multiple components obtained from the conventional linear transformation are possibly irrelevant, and usually do not possess the characteristics of statistical independence. Therefore a method of signal decomposition and reconstruction is proposed based on the independent function element. This method not only inherits the advantages of linear transformation, but also has the capability of signal representation in the statistical domain. In this paper, the model, definition and obtaining method of independent function element are discussed, and the applications of heart sounds independent function element in the heart sound signal processing are also analyzed in detail. The validity and practicability of the method are demonstrated through two experiments.
